The Left Party in Karlskrona has ignited a political debate after announcing gender-segregated preparatory meetings ahead of their annual meeting scheduled for March 7. According to reports, women and men have been directed to separate addresses for these preliminary gatherings, a practice that has drawn sharp criticism from other local politicians. ' Left Party group leader Henrik Holmkvist defended the practice, stating that gender-segregated meetings are part of the party's internal feminist work.
Holmkvist explained that men tend to take up more space in discussions than women, and the separate meetings aim to support female members who can seek support from other women to make their voices heard. The party has reportedly held gender-segregated meetings for several years before annual meetings, but this year's invitation sparked unexpected debate on social media, prompting the party to explain their reasoning on their Facebook page.
